Solubility of [3-(dimethylamino)-1-methyl-3-oxo-prop-1-enyl] dimethyl phosphate
The solubility of the compound [3-(dimethylamino)-1-methyl-3-oxo-prop-1-enyl] dimethyl phosphate can be quite intriguing due to its unique structure and functional groups. This compound exhibits a range of solubility behaviors depending on its environment.
Key Factors Influencing Solubility:
In general, the compound is likely to be more soluble in polar solvents like water, as well as in organic solvents such as ethanol and methanol. However, it may have reduced solubility in non-polar solvents such as hexane due to the lack of favorable interactions.
